So, what is Charles Haley doing today? The answer requires peeling back years of physical punishment. It requires separating the Hall of Fame rings from the human being who earned them. Haley now operates in the space few athletes reach without massive scaffolding. The space of internal reckoning.

The Physical Toll and Daily Reality

The toll on a defensive end is not linear. It compounds. Every season with the Cowboys meant another collision, another brain-rattling hit. Today, Haley carries the visible markers of a player who was built different. He has spoken openly about the physical limitations that define his morning routine.

He wakes up managing pain that would send most people running to the nearest specialist. The body keeps the score, as they say. For Haley, the scoreboard reads damage, but the narrative reads survival.

His daily reality involves a strict regimen of mental and physical maintenance. He does not dwell on the past glory of his five Super Bowl rings. Those rings symbolize a price he paid in full. Today, Haley focuses on the small, unglamorous moments of mobility that most people ignore until they are gone.

Transitioning Beyond the Field

The transition from football star to everyday citizen is a bridge most players burn. Haley refuses to pretend the transition was seamless. He knows the identity crisis hits hard when the playbook is gone. The cheering stops. The cameras turn away.

Haley leveraged his platform into advocacy work. He has spent years pushing for better health protocols and safety measures in the sport. He saw friends deteriorate. He saw the mental fog settle in during the prime of his life. That experience forged a new mission.

Advocacy and Mental Health Focus

Mental health awareness is not a trend for Haley. It is a survival mechanism. He speaks publicly about the psychological residue of playing a violent sport for over a decade. His advocacy is not theoretical. It is rooted in the faces of former teammates who did not make it out the other side.

He has worked with various organizations to highlight the dangers of chronic traumatic encephalopathy, or CTE. The conversation around head injuries in the NFL has evolved, but Haley insists the sport must move faster. He pushes for rule changes that prioritize player longevity over entertainment value. A Legacy Built on Grit, Not Gold

Charles Haley’s legacy is not just the hardware in the display case. It is the sheer force of will required to play through injuries that would bench lesser men. The "Hulk Hogan of football" played with a broken spirit and a fractured body.

Today, he represents a specific kind of toughness. One that acknowledges fragility. He stands as a warning and a testament. The work he does now is preventative. He wants the next generation of linemen to live long enough to enjoy the money they made.

The contrast between his on-field aggression and his off-field demeanor is stark. On the field, he was a predator. Off the field, he is a careful student of his own health. That shift in focus from destroying opponents to preserving himself is the most underrated part of his career.

Life Outside the Spotlight

When the cameras are off, Charles Haley returns to his family and his roots. He is not chasing endorsement deals or public appearances. The noise of the NFL era has faded to a hum. His current life prioritizes stability over stardom.

He dedicates his time to mentoring young athletes. The goal is to steer them away from the same traps he faced. He warns them about the financial pitfalls and the psychological isolation that follows fame. Haley uses his hard-earned scars as a map for others.

The work is unsung. There are no highlight packages for a man teaching a teenager how to handle sudden wealth. There are no statues for cautionary advice. But for Haley, the goal is not legacy through trophies. The goal is legacy through impact.
